google.maps.LatLng
類
大多數方法如果接收 LatLng類的話,同樣接收 LatLngLiteral ,比如設置地圖中心點:
map.setCenter(new google.maps.LatLng(30, 104));
map.setCenter({lat: 30, lng: 104});
構造器同樣接收 LatLngLiteral 類,比如:
myLatLng = new google.maps.LatLng({lat: 30, lng: 104});
構造器 | |
---|---|
LatLng( | 創建一個點,lat:-90到90,lng:-180到180 |
方法 | |
---|---|
equals( | Return Value: 比對兩個 點是否相等 |
lat() | Return Value: 返回緯度 |
lng() | Return Value: 返回經度 |
toJSON() | Return Value: 轉化成JSON格式 |
toString() | Return Value: 轉化成字符串格式 |
屬性 | |
---|---|
lat | Type: 緯度 |
lng | Type: 緯度 |
google.maps.LatLngBounds
類
構造函數 | |
---|---|
LatLngBounds( | 以給定的點創建一個LatLngBounds |
方法 | |
---|---|
contains( | Return Value: 判斷一個點是否在LatLngBounds內 |
equals( | Return Value: 判斷兩個 LatLngBounds 是否相等 |
extend( | Return Value: 增加一個點 |
getCenter() | Return Value: 返回計算出的中心點 |
getNorthEast() | Return Value: 返回東北角 |
getSouthWest() | Return Value: 返回西南角 |
intersects( | Return Value: 判斷兩個 LatLngBounds 有無公共點 |
isEmpty() | Return Value: 返回是否空 LatLngBounds |
toJSON() | Return Value: 轉化為JSON |
toSpan() | Return Value: 轉化成 lat/lng span. |
toString() | Return Value: 轉化成字符串 |
union( | Return Value: 合并兩個 LatLngBounds |
google.maps.LatLngBoundsLiteral
對象
屬性 | |
---|---|
east | Type: 東經 |
north | Type: 北緯 |
south | Type: 南緯 |
west | Type: 西經 |
google.maps.Point
類
構造器 | |
---|---|
Point( | 以給定的值創建點 |
方法 | |
---|---|
equals( | Return Value: 對比兩個點 |
toString() | Return Value: 轉化為JSON |
屬性 | |
---|---|
x | Type: X坐標 |
y | Type: Y坐標 |
google.maps.Size
類
構造函數 | |
---|---|
Size( | 創建一個Size類 |
方法 | |
---|---|
equals( | Return Value: 對比兩個Size類 |
toString() | Return Value: 轉化為JSON |
Properties | |
---|---|
height | Type: 高度 |
width | Type: 寬度 |